Understanding the Threat Landscape in Online Banking

Online banking exposes users to a variety of cyber risks, ranging from data interception to sophisticated phishing attacks. Cybercriminals frequently target individuals using unsecured Wi-Fi networks, such as those found in coffee shops, airports, or hotels, where they can easily intercept financial data. The 2023 Data Breach Investigations Report by Verizon revealed that over 80% of hacking-related breaches involved the use of stolen credentials, often obtained through insecure network connections or social engineering.

Malware, man-in-the-middle attacks, and DNS spoofing are just a few tactics hackers use to steal sensitive information. Once attackers gain access to your banking credentials or session cookies, they can transfer funds, make unauthorized purchases, or sell your data on the dark web. As online banking becomes more integrated into daily life, protecting your connection has never been more crucial.

How a VPN Secures Your Online Banking Activities

A VPN acts as a secure tunnel between your device and the internet, encrypting all data transmitted—including your banking credentials, account numbers, and transaction details. This encryption makes it nearly impossible for hackers, Internet Service Providers (ISPs), or even government agencies to monitor or tamper with your online activities.

Here’s how a VPN specifically enhances security during online banking:

1. $1 VPNs use protocols like OpenVPN, WireGuard, or IKEv2 to encrypt traffic with 256-bit AES encryption, which is considered unbreakable by current computing standards. 2. $1 By routing your connection through a remote server, a VPN hides your actual IP address, making it difficult for cybercriminals to trace your location or launch targeted attacks. 3. $1 VPNs prevent attackers on the same public network from intercepting your banking session or stealing your login credentials. 4. $1 In some countries, certain banking websites may be censored or geo-blocked. A VPN allows secure access from anywhere without exposing your real location.

A study by the Identity Theft Resource Center found that users who consistently used a VPN for sensitive activities, such as online banking, reported 40% fewer incidents of identity theft compared to those who did not.

Best Practices: Using a VPN for Online Banking

While a VPN provides a robust layer of security, its effectiveness depends on how you use it. Here are essential best practices to maximize your protection:

- $1 Ensure your VPN is active before you log into your bank’s website or app. This prevents your credentials from being exposed on unencrypted networks. - $1 Some banks may flag international logins as suspicious. To avoid account lockouts, select a VPN server in your home country or city when accessing your bank. - $1 A kill switch automatically disconnects your internet if the VPN connection drops, preventing accidental data exposure. DNS leak protection ensures your device doesn’t send DNS requests outside the encrypted VPN tunnel. - $1 Free VPNs often lack strong encryption, may log your data, or inject ads and malware. Invest in a reputable, paid VPN for financial activities. - $1 Even the best VPN cannot protect you if your device is infected with malware or running outdated software. Regularly update your operating system and banking apps.

Comparing VPN Features for Secure Banking: What to Look For

Choosing the right VPN can be overwhelming given the vast number of providers on the market. Here’s a comparison table highlighting the key features to look for when selecting a VPN for online banking:

Feature Why It Matters for Online Banking Recommended Minimum Standard
Encryption Strength Protects sensitive transaction data from interception AES-256 bit
No-Logs Policy Ensures your browsing data and banking activities are not stored Strict audited no-logs
Kill Switch Prevents accidental exposure if VPN disconnects Automatic kill switch
DNS/IPv6 Leak Protection Blocks leaks that could expose banking activity Integrated DNS/IPv6 leak protection
Server Locations Allows connection from your home country to avoid bank blocks Servers in your country
Multi-Device Support Protects all your devices (PC, phone, tablet) At least 5 devices
Customer Support Assists in troubleshooting connection or security issues 24/7 live support

Some of the most trusted VPNs for online banking in 2024 include NordVPN, ExpressVPN, and Proton VPN, each offering strong encryption, strict no-logs policies, and extensive server networks.

Additional Security Tips for Online Banking

A VPN is just one component of a robust online banking security strategy. Combine it with these additional precautions for maximum safety:

- $1 Most major banks offer 2FA, requiring you to enter a verification code sent to your phone or generated by an app. This makes it much harder for attackers to access your account, even if they steal your password. - $1 Regularly review your bank statements and transaction history for unauthorized activity. Set up real-time alerts for large transactions or login attempts. - $1 Avoid using easily guessable passwords like "123456" or your birthday. Instead, use a complex mix of letters, numbers, and symbols, and consider a password manager to keep track of them. - $1 Always double-check the URL before entering your login details, and never click on banking links in unsolicited emails or text messages. - $1 Don’t just close your browser or app—log out properly to end your banking session and reduce the risk of session hijacking.

According to a 2023 report by Javelin Strategy & Research, users who practiced good password hygiene and enabled account alerts experienced 70% fewer unauthorized banking incidents.

Common Misconceptions About VPNs and Online Banking

Despite the clear benefits, several myths persist about the use of VPNs for online banking. Let’s debunk a few:

- $1 While VPNs can slightly reduce your internet speed due to encryption overhead, modern VPNs are optimized for fast connections. For most users, the difference is negligible during banking sessions. - $1 Not all VPNs offer the same level of protection. Some free or poorly maintained services may log your data or leak your real IP address. - $1 Some banks may flag access from unfamiliar locations, but this is easily resolved by choosing a server in your home region. Most reputable VPNs offer a wide range of local servers to avoid triggering security alerts. - $1 While VPNs hide your IP and encrypt traffic, other tracking methods (like browser fingerprinting or malware) can still compromise your privacy. Always pair VPN use with good security habits.

Understanding these nuances will help you use a VPN more effectively and avoid unnecessary disruptions during your online banking sessions.

FAQ

Can I use a free VPN for online banking?
It’s not recommended. Free VPNs often lack strong encryption, may log your data, and sometimes inject ads or malware. For financial transactions, always use a reputable paid VPN with robust security features.
Will my bank account get locked if I use a VPN?
Most banks will not lock your account just for VPN use, but accessing your account from a different country may trigger security checks. To avoid issues, connect to a VPN server in your home country or region.
Does using a VPN make my online banking completely safe?
A VPN greatly enhances your security by encrypting your data and hiding your IP address, but it does not protect against all threats. Combine VPN use with strong passwords, two-factor authentication, and vigilance against phishing.
How do I know if my VPN is leaking data?
You can test for IP and DNS leaks using online tools such as ipleak.net or dnsleaktest.com. Ensure your VPN offers DNS and IPv6 leak protection and always keep your client updated.
Will a VPN slow down my online banking experience?
A VPN may slightly reduce your internet speed due to encryption, but reputable services are optimized for fast connections. For most users, the difference is minimal and does not affect banking tasks.
